01 of 13 Crochet Cherry Blossom Keychain

Learn how to crochet a simple and flat cherry blossom with a keyring attachment following this tutorial. This Sakura is worked in rounds as a single piece using stitches of different heights. For the string, just chain the yarn in the last round and slip stitch.

It will be easy to crochet this flower keychain even for beginners. Just be comfortable with the change of colors. Learn in just 13 minutes with a leaf pattern as a bonus. It uses two shades of pink.

02 of 13 Crochet Cherry Blossom Hairclip

Crochet a unique cherry blossom hairclip (a stem of little cherry blossoms) following this stitch-by-stitch tutorial. This Sakura stem looks so cute with the Sakura in different sizes. For the centre part, the tutor has even used the dark shade of pink.

This hairclip is worked in flat rows and rounds and can be finished within 15 minutes. You should be comfortable with the small parts. After you finish, attach a long hairclip.

07 of 13 Bendable Crochet Cherry Plant

Learn how to crochet a beginner-friendly guide for crocheting a realistic Cherry Blossom branch, complete with petals, buds, and leaves. The creator utilizes a “back loop” technique for the petals to achieve a delicate, lifelike texture, carefully building both five-petal and three-petal flower variations.

It uses craft wire in the leaves and buds; the pieces become poseable and sturdy. The assembly phase is particularly clever, using yarn-wrapping techniques to blend individual clusters.

08 of 13 Crochet Cherry Blossom Keychain

Learn how to crochet a charming Crochet Sakura (Cherry Blossom) Bag Charm. The project doubles as a mini pouch, perfect for storing small items like AirPods or coins. By using 5-ply milk cotton and a 3.5 mm hook, the designer ensures the pouch is both sturdy and soft.

The pattern cleverly uses front post stitches and varied stitch heights to mimic the delicate, notched petals of a real cherry blossom.

11 of 13 Crochet Cherry Blossom Earrings

Learn how to crochet a beginner-friendly, step-by-step guide to crocheting Cherry Earrings, perfect for spring. The project uses size 2 cotton yarn, a 1.5 mm hook, and basic supplies like earring hangers and fiberfill.

The clever use of needle shaping to create the cherry’s dimple adds a touch of realism that elevates the design. Lightweight and colorful, these earrings are not only a great way to use up scrap yarn but also serve as a delightful, personalized gift.
